Pet supplies dubai pet store dubai pet shop dubaiIn summary, Petzone presents a diverse selection of pet products and services, with positive feed-back on staff members care and product assortment. What precisely Is that this black position, much like a mole on our six-thirty day period-past six thirty day period https://billh666lhc1.blog-eye.com/profile